Best Practices for Insurance Company Website Design
Professional User Interface Design
Creating a professional website design for business-to-consumer industries is unique in many ways. Tackling website design for insurance agencies is even more unique in that we all need insurance, whether it’s auto insurance, life insurance or business insurance. We all invest a lot of money with insurance brokers and the amount of money we spend each year on insurance products and services alone requires a great deal of consumer confidence. This confidence is born almost instantly when we visit an insurance company online through a highly professional, polished website design. The first impression a new visitor experiences with the agency’s brand is the first and most crucial step in the journey from prospect to customer.
